Why are the negative numbers included?

When you multiply two negative numbers together, you get a positive number. That means both the positive and negative numbers are factors of 1,511,875.

Example:
1 x 1,511,875 = 1,511,875
and
-1 x -1,511,875 = 1,511,875
Notice both answers equal 1,511,875
